> > The utf16_le_to_7bit function claims to, naively, convert a UTF-16
> > string to a 7-bit ASCII string. By naively, we mean that it:
> >  * drops the first byte of every character in the original UTF-16 string
> >  * checks if all characters are printable, and otherwise replaces them
> >    by exclamation mark "!".
> > 
> > This means that theoretically, all characters outside the 7-bit ASCII
> > range should be replaced by another character. Examples:
> > 
> >  * lower-case alpha (ɒ) 0x0252 becomes 0x52 (R)
> >  * ligature OE (œ) 0x0153 becomes 0x53 (S)
> >  * hangul letter pieup (ㅂ) 0x3142 becomes 0x42 (B)
> >  * upper-case gamma (Ɣ) 0x0194 becomes 0x94 (not printable) so gets
> >    replaced by "!"  
> 
> Also any character with low 8 bits equal to 0 terminates the string.

> > The result of this conversion for the GPT partition name is passed to
> > user-space as PARTNAME via udev, which is confusing and feels questionable.  
> 
> Indeed.  But this change seems to make it worse!
> 
> [...]
> > This results in many values which should be replaced by "!" to be kept
> > as-is, despite not being valid 7-bit ASCII. Examples:
> > 
> >  * e with acute accent (é) 0x00E9 becomes 0xE9 - kept as-is because
> >    isprint(0xE9) returns 1.
> >
> >  * euro sign (€) 0x20AC becomes 0xAC - kept as-is because isprint(0xAC)
> >    returns 1.

> Now we map 'é' to 'i' and '€' to ','.  Didn't we want to map them to
> '!'?
> 
> We shouldn't mask the input character; instead we should do a range
> check before calling isprint().  Something like:
> 
> 	u16 uc = le16_to_cpu(in[i]);
> 	u8 c;
> 
> 	if (uc < 0x80 && (uc == 0 || isprint(uc)))

Given that, for 7-bit ascii, isprint(uc) is equivalent to (uc >= 0x20 && uc <= 0x7e)
you can do:
	if (uc >= 0x20 && uc <= 0x7e)
		c = uc;
	else
		c = uc ? '!' : 0;
